This book started off VERY strong! I loved it! The book just grabbed me and I was hooked. It's like a thriller, murder mystery and slightly horror rolled in one novel. That's 3 of my 4 favorite genres rolled in one! SCORE!! It made me think of Agatha Chrisie novels!

The MFC is a bad a$$ lawyer but could totally double as a detective. Her paralegal is a firecracker. Her investigator was retired military.

This is number 6 in a series. It was so well written that I had no clue it was that far in the series until I went to Goodreads. So obviously, this can be a stand alone book as well. Bonus points added for that aspect
